Silver Street station is a compact yet well-equipped hub for travelers. With ticket machines available for quick and easy purchases and the option to collect your pre-booked tickets, your journey can begin even smoother. It is worth noting that while ticket machines are accessible, the ticket office operates limited hours from 06:30 to 10:00, Monday through Friday.
For those needing extra assistance, you’ll find help points and staff ready to lend a hand during peak hours in the mornings until early afternoon. Although the station doesn't provide waiting rooms, ample seating is available, ensuring a comfortable wait before your train arrives. CCTV is in place for enhanced security.
Step-free access is continually available throughout the station, affirming its commitment to easy accessibility for everyone. Unfortunately, facilities like ATMs, toilets, and refreshment outlets are currently unavailable; however, the nearby vicinity provides plenty of options.
Silver Street station not only makes rail travel possible but offers effortless connectivity to other public transport options. Transport for London buses are a convenient option from outside the station, providing a seamless transition to further destinations. For those occasions when rail services might be disrupted, a Rail Replacement Service is available, with northbound buses stopping in Fore Street en route to Enfield Town or Cheshunt, and southbound services heading toward Liverpool Street.

The station prides itself on user-friendly ticketing options. With a ticket office operational Monday through Saturday from 06:55 to 13:30 and ticket machines available for those outside these hours, purchasing or collecting tickets bought online remains hassle-free. Additionally, these machines support Disabled Persons Railcard discounts to ensure accessibility for all passengers.
As you navigate the station, you'll find helpful staff available during the same hours as the ticket office to answer questions or assist with your travel needs. For auditory announcements and visual departure screens, London Road (Brighton) ensures you're updated on your journey. And if you need more personalized assistance, help points are conveniently located on the platforms.
Although not all areas offer step-free access, the station provides options to accommodate travelers with mobility needs. Ramps are available for train access, though it’s essential to arrange this in advance or upon arrival if needed. Staff trained to provide assistance aboard trains can help ensure a smooth journey. Remember, arriving 20 minutes early allows staff to coordinate any required accessibility assistance at your destination or connecting stations.
While there are no accessible restrooms or waiting rooms, seating areas are present for comfort while you wait for your train.
